## Deploying the Gatewick Proctor Queue

Deploys are pretty painless: push to main, wait for the pipeline, then watch the queue drain dashboard for five minutes. If candidates pile up mid-exam, roll back first and ask questions later — the queue replays safely. Everything the workers care about lives in one config block, shown here for reference.

settings of bafof-yagef:
JOROX_PIN=8740
JOROX_TENANT=pelox
JOROX_METRICS_HOST=metrics.jorox.qorvelworks.internal
JOROX_SEAL=seal_c78f63c1
JOROX_STANDBY_TEAM=norax

= Expansion: Caldereth Region (Managers Only) =

Orientation page for the incoming director. Market entry into Caldereth begins next fiscal year, anchored by a distribution hub in Norbray. Local partnerships are handled by the Ferrin team; regulatory filings are complete. Hiring opens in the second quarter. The agreed strategic positioning is set out in the note below.

board note of bawep-tajef: Queniusek Systems plans to raise the Quenvan list price by 53.1 percent in March. The pricing group signed off on a budget of $176.4 million for Project Drueth. The renewal with Casionix Partners closes at $142.5 million a year, 8.3 percent below the last contract. Project Fraax slips by six weeks because of the tooling delay.

Title: Scheduler double-waters bed 3 after DST shift

New folks: the Verdella scheduler stores watering slots in local time. After the clock change, slot 06:00 fires twice, soaking the herb bed. Fix: store UTC, convert at display. Repro on the Oakhollow test rig only. To reproduce, install the firmware identified by the token below.

build token for hafop-kahog: htk31_a432ac515d5bb1362002c1e1a7e80ef

### Step 4: Tune template rendering

Quick one for review: Brindlecast's template cache was thrashing under load, so we bumped `TEMPLATE_CACHE_SIZE=2048` and enabled `RENDER_PRECOMPILE=true` in `.env.production`. This cut p95 render time roughly in half on the Tarnow staging box. Partial includes are now memoized too, so watch for stale fragments after content edits. The renderer still needs to sign its cache entries, so the signing secret goes directly below this sentence.

env line for fafof-fahag: LEDGER_TOKEN5=f8790